Community Verdict
Dre Dennis delivered a dominant performance, showcasing consistent lyrical skill and an aggressive stage presence that resonated strongly with the audience. Many fans considered it a clear 'body bag' victory, with Rush TYG struggling to match the intensity and precision.
Dre Dennis stepped into the Gates of the Garden ring against Rush TYG and left no doubt about his intentions, delivering a performance that many in the crowd and online declared a decisive victory. Dennis showcased his signature aggressive style and intricate wordplay, landing punch after punch that had the audience reacting. His consistency and ability to craft impactful schemes were on full display, solidifying his reputation as a 'haymaker king.' Rush TYG, while showing flashes of potential, struggled to match Dennis's intensity and lyrical precision.
Despite some fans acknowledging his growth, his material often fell flat or was perceived as 'corny' by a significant portion of the viewership. The battle's lopsided nature led to a mixed reaction, with some questioning the matchup itself, while others simply celebrated Dre Dennis's dominant showing. The atmosphere was charged, though not without its distractions.
Gwitty's energetic crowd participation, while entertaining for some, was also noted by others as disruptive to the flow of the battle. Even with these interjections, Dre Dennis maintained his focus, delivering lines that resonated long after the final word, proving why he's considered a consistent force in the scene.
